新闻中心

EEPW首页 > 嵌入式系统 > 高校动态 > 瑞典IAR公司开始在华推广EWARM大学计划!

瑞典IAR公司开始在华推广EWARM大学计划!

——
作者:时间:2008-01-02来源:嵌入式技术网收藏

      Systems是全球领先的系统开发工具和服务的供应商。公司成立于1983年,迄今已有20余载,一直专心致力于为客户缩短产品开发的时间而不懈努力。提供的产品和服务涉及到系统的设计、开发和测试的每一个阶段,包括:带有C/C++编译器和调试器的集成开发环境(IDE)、实时操作系统和中间件、开发套件、硬件仿真器以及状态机设计工具。   

    公司总部在北欧的,在美国、日本、英国、德国、比利时、巴西和中国设有分公司,其产品卖到了全球30个国家。它最著名的产品是C Complier- Embedded Workbench, 支持几乎所有知名半导体公司的MCU、DSP等微处理器。许多全球著名的公司都在使用 SYSTEMS提供的开发工具,技术支持和工程服务,用以开发他们的前沿产品,从智能卡到X射线系统,到手机、蓝牙等通信系统.... 

    为进一步推动教育在大专院校的普及,IAR Systems公司与北京博创科技合作,针对中国大陆的大专院校联合推出高性能、低价格的ARM开发工具包。  

开发工具:代码小,效率高  

    IAR 是一套支持ARM所有处理器的集成开发环境,包含项目管理器、编辑器、C/C++编译器、汇编器、连接器和调试器。在环境下可以使用C/C++和汇编语言方便地开发ARM嵌入式应用程序,比较其他的ARM开发环境,IAR 的EWARM具有入门容易、使用方便、代码紧凑等特点。 

最广泛的内核支持,包括最新的Cortex M3 

精致的优化功能 

    EWARM允许对用户选择对代码大小或执行速度实行多级优化,同时还允许对项目中作不同的全局和局部优化配置,以达到速度和代码尺寸的平衡。EWARM还支持对优化级别的微调,以及对单个函数的特定优化配置。高级的全局优化与针对特定芯片优化相结合,可以生成最为紧凑、有效的代码。


μC/OS-II内核识别调试

    EWARM中的C-SPY调试器免费集成了μC/OS-II内核识别(Kernel Awareness)插件,通过它可以在IAR调试器中显示μC/OS-II内部数据结构窗口,从而了解每一个项目应用中运行任务的信息,每一个信号灯、互斥量、邮箱、队列、事件标志信息,以及等待上述内核对象的所有任务列表信息。

 

灵活的加密方式,适合多人使用

    EWARM无论是单机版还是网络版,都将提供用户加密狗,用户可以根据需要在多台PC上灵活使用该软件,无须担心由于硬盘崩溃、软件升级而造成的License号丢失。

自动烧写Flash

    EWARM为绝大多数ARM芯片提供了Flash Loader。当调试器启动时,Flash Loader同时被调用,自动将程序下载到Flash。Flash Loader完全集成在EWARM中,烧写过程中无需特殊的Flash编程工具和软件。 

IAR J-Link仿真器——下载速度高达800K/S

    IAR J-Link仿真器可以直接与EWARM集成开发环境无缝连接,无需安装任何驱动程序, 操作方便、连接方便、简单易学,是学习开发ARM最实用的开发工具。

IAR J-Link标准版 

linux操作系统文章专题:linux操作系统详解(linux不再难懂)


评论


相关推荐

技术专区

关闭